ungulateman

Miltank Man!
Earthquake, always and forever. By the way, EVs only boost stats up to 252 EVs, so put the last 4 EVs you're currently wasting into HP. Flamethrower or Fire Blast are good options over Fire Fang.
 

xMetagrossx

Blaziking
^i second EQ the only practical reason to use Fly to avoid damage for a turn is if you inflict a status like Toxic, have Leftovers or you opponent is useing a 2 turn move such as Solarbeam. All of which dnt apply to Salamence
